Commission to appropriate bond proceeds for Nolan turf, Red Bank playground improvements
Summary
Res. 826-20 would appropriate $162,327 from a 2024 bond issue for synthetic turf at Nolan Elementary and $100,000 for playground and field improvements at Red Bank Elementary. Commissioners sought details on scope for the Red Bank allocation (staff said shade and small upgrades).

Res. 826-20 was read to appropriate proceeds from a 2024 bond issue: $162,327 to Hamilton County Schools for a synthetic turf field at Nolan Elementary School and $100,000 for playground and field improvements at Red Bank Elementary School.
A commissioner asked about the Red Bank allocation and whether the amount would cover meaningful upgrades; staff said the $100,000 was a late addition requested to provide shade and upgrade one or two playground pieces and that accessibility improvements had been funded previously. "I know it's shade, and then I think maybe an upgrade of a piece or two, of the playground," a staff member said. The item was assigned for consideration next week.
